- Llangollen Advertiser Denbighshire Merionethshire and North Wales Journal 11/01/1901: 2 fire stations - chief one and one at lower part of town
http://newspapers.library.wales/view/3603933/3603936/19/
- Carnarvon and Denbigh Herald and North and South Wales Independent 23/09/1898: lists details of a loan of '£225 for Craigydon fire station, repayable on 20 years' [could this refer to the fire station at the 'lower part of town'?]
http://www.craigydon.co.uk/home/craig-y-don-history/
- 1899: Fire station housing a small horse-drawn manually operated pump built on Queen’s Road
Shown on 1912 1:2500 OS map |
